
VRT, the Dutch-language Belgian national broadcaster, ANNOUNCED the return of Eurosong back in August, for the 2023 Eurovision Song Contest.
VRT have announced further details now – this time regarding song submissions. Open song submissions will not form part of the Eurosong 2023 selection process. Instead, the broadcaster has decided to work directly with record labels to find the Eurosong 2023 acts.
Gerrit Kerremans, VRT music coordinator, had the following to say:
“Due to the late decision to organise a pre-selection on Een. The A&R team has consulted a wide group of record labels and managers regarding the availability of potential candidates.”
